/* Original Menu */

/* Side menu */
#container .modtitle {
	color: #333333;
}

#container ul.menu li a {
	color: #333333;
	text-decoration: none;
}

#container ul.menu li a span {
	padding-left: 16px;
	background: url(./images/bullet-gray.gif) no-repeat 5px 5px;
}

#container ul.menu li a:hover,
#container ul.menu li a:active,
#container ul.menu li a:focus {
	color: #333333;
	background-color: #DDDDDD;
}

#container ul.menu li.active a {
	background-color: #eeffbf;
	color: #52983e;
}

#container ul.menu li.active a span {
	background: url(./images/bullet-green.gif) no-repeat 5px 5px;
}

#container ul.menu li li a {
	color: #333333;
}

#container ul.menu li ul li a:hover,
#container ul.menu li ul li a:active,
#container ul.menu li ul li a:focus {
	background-color: #DDDDDD;
}

#container ul.menu li li a span {
	background: url(./images/bullet-gray.gif) no-repeat 5px;
}

/* Main navi */
/* -------- Top level -------- */
#mainnavwrap {
	background-color: #88B074;
	border-top-color: #A4C594;
	border-bottom-color: #658854;
}

#mainnav > ul {
	background-color: #88B074;
}

#mainnav > ul > li {
	background-color: #88B074;
	border-left-color: #A4C594;
	border-right-color: #658854;

}

#mainnav > ul > li.active {
	background-color: #88B074;
	color: #E4EFDF;
}

#mainnav > ul > li:hover,
#mainnav > ul > li:active,
#mainnav > ul > li:focus {
	background-color: #9DBF8C;
	color: #E4EFDF;
}

/* -------- sub-levels -------- */
#mainnav ul ul li {
	border-left-color: #A4C594;
	border-right-color: #658854;
	border-top-color: #A4C594;
	border-bottom-color: #658854;
}

#mainnav li ul { /* second-level lists */
	background-color: #9DBF8C;
}

#mainnav li a {
	color: #E4EFDF;
}

#mainnav ul ul  li:hover,
#mainnav ul ul  li:active,
#mainnav ul ul  li:focus {
	background-color: #88B074;
	color: #E4EFDF;
}
